1. Wander Through the Medieval Old Town

The Medieval Old Town of Rhodes is a UNESCO World Heritage site that transports you back in time with its well-preserved medieval Architecture and narrow cobblestone streets. Begin your Exploration at the impressive Grand Master's Palace, which serves as the centerpiece of this historic area. Stroll through the ancient streets of the Knights, and don’t forget to visit The Archaeological Museum housed in the old hospital of the Knights.

2. Marvel at the Acropolis of Rhodes

Perched on Monte Smith Hill, The Acropolis of Rhodes offers stunning panoramic Views of the city and the surrounding coastline. Explore the ancient Ruins of The Temple of Apollo and The Odeon, an ancient Theater that once hosted grand Performances. The site also features remnants of the Hellenistic period, showcasing the rich history of Rhodes.

4. Visit the Rhodes Jewish Museum

The Rhodes Jewish Museum offers a poignant look into the Jewish community’s history in Rhodes. Located in the heart of The Old Town, the museum features Artifacts, photographs, and personal stories that shed light on the vibrant Jewish life in the region before World War II. It's a must-visit for history enthusiasts and those interested in cultural Heritage.

5. Explore the Ancient City of Ialysos

Just a short drive From Rhodes City, the ancient city of Ialysos is worth a visit for its archaeological Significance. Explore the Ruins of the Temple of Athena and the Roman baths, and enjoy a leisurely walk through the ancient streets. This site provides insight into the early history of the island and its role in ancient Greek civilization.

7. Stroll Through Mandraki Harbor

Mandraki Harbor is a vibrant area that blends Historical significance with modern charm. Here, you can see the iconic deer statues, which are replicas of the Colossus of Rhodes, one of the Seven Wonders of the Ancient World. Enjoy a leisurely walk along the Waterfront, and take in the Views of the bustling Harbor and the historic Windmills.

9. Explore the Acropolis of Lindos

A short trip From Rhodes City, the Acropolis of Lindos is a must-see for its breathtaking location and Historical significance. The site features the Remains of a classical Temple dedicated to Athena, and the climb up to The Acropolis offers stunning Views of Lindos and the surrounding coastline. The charming village of Lindos, with its whitewashed houses and narrow streets, is also worth exploring.
